Chris Wong is an assistant casino host with Royal Caribbean. He first started working for the company in 2013 and has worked on four different ships with the cruise line. 

What’s a typical day like in a Royal Caribbean casino?

Chris told Express.co.uk: “My job is to reward casino players based on their level of play which is determined by their gaming action.

“The loyalty program is a points-based system, which means the more points players earn during a cruise, the more perks and benefits we offer.”

Incredible perks could include complimentary cruises, free dinners in the ship’s specialty restaurant or shopping expenses onboard.

Chris added: “I will be constantly engaging and interacting with our guests playing in the casino, building rapport, and catering to their requests.”

Working on a cruise ship can involve very long hours and a lot of time spent away from home.

However, Chris said: “This job has allowed me to travel the world and explore destinations I could have only dreamed of visiting.

“I now have friendships that span the globe, and a greater appreciation for all the different culture my fellow crew members come from.

“Working on a cruise ship is unlike any other job in the world. You can quite literally wake up in a new destination on an almost daily basis.
